I would not be surprised if the incentive went for awhile. The incentive prior to the 15% was a $7 reduction in price, 100 free developer points and no dues for 2005. Based upon a $10 per point value this brought the cost down to around $79 per point. Based upon the reasle boards it appears that there were people who added on points in the hope of getting a free vaction with plans on selling them when the points returned to $98 per point. Disney was losing sales because they were competing against the resellers who were willing to sell in the $80 to make a profit and capture the developer points. By selling at the current incentive rate of $83.30 that took the re-sellers out of the the market. It appears that there are a lot of Saratoga points up for re-sale on the board. Just a thought.

2 Things - My guide said the 15% discount was modeled on the Employee Discount programs that Ford and GM did this past summer. He said its been a very successful program and at some point this month they will end it - he pointe d out that were already on quota for sales so this 15% discount was simply a pilot program (he also said it was not advertised to the general public, only to DVC members). He did say that DVC may launch this program again sometime next year. Whether this is true, who knows, but thats what he said.
The 2nd point: I was told last week that if I sign up I can get June 1st as my User Year date. This week I was told that they are no longer offering the June 1st daet but are now offering August 1st (I can still get June since it was offered to me already). He did say the August date would not last for long since they really don't need to do it in order to close business.
